Gasperini and Ranieri Await Friedkin’s Verdict Amidst Tense Meetings

Despite recent indications of support from AS Roma’s owners, coach Gian Piero Gasperini’s position remains precarious following a significant conflict with Senior Advisor Claudio Ranieri last week.

The atmosphere at Roma is reportedly becoming increasingly strained, with multiple reports suggesting that either Gasperini or Ranieri will depart the club at the conclusion of the current season.

Ranieri publicly responded to criticisms from Gasperini prior to a match against Pisa. Gasperini had previously voiced his dissatisfaction regarding the club’s transfer dealings and the handling of injured players.

Following Ranieri’s public statement, a tense meeting took place at Trigoria earlier this week, which also involved sporting director Frederic Massara, according to Gazzetta. The report from “La Gazzetta dello Sport” indicates that Ranieri even contemplated resigning after this latest disagreement. Simultaneously, Gasperini held a conference call with the club’s owners.

Owners Dan and Ryan Friedkin find themselves in a challenging situation. They reportedly view Ranieri as a cornerstone of their long-term project but also acknowledge Gasperini’s contributions on the field this season. Consequently, they must make a definitive decision regarding Gasperini or Ranieri for the 2026-27 season, as their working relationship appears to be beyond repair.

Furthermore, reports suggest that Gasperini is displeased that some of Ranieri’s close associates have received contract extensions without his consultation. Ed Shipley, a key figure for the Friedkins in Rome, has also reportedly submitted reports detailing instances of Gasperini’s alleged inappropriate conduct.

AS Roma appointed Gasperini last summer, and his current contract is set to run until 2028.
